Construction labourers perform a wide range of duties depending on the project and employer. They may prepare construction sites, move materials, load and unload equipment, assist skilled workers, clean work areas, dig trenches, and operate basic tools. Some labourers may also work on roads, residential buildings, commercial projects, warehouses, and infrastructure developments.

Types of Construction Labourer Jobs Available
US employers may offer different construction labourer positions depending on the project.
General Construction Labourer
General labourers assist construction teams with site preparation, material handling, cleanup, and other basic tasks.
Construction Helper
Construction helpers support carpenters, electricians, plumbers, masons, and other skilled tradespeople with tools, materials, and general work.
Road Construction Labourer
Road construction labourers may help prepare work areas, move materials, maintain construction zones, and support road-building crews.
Concrete Labourer
Concrete labourers assist with preparing work areas, mixing materials, carrying supplies, and supporting concrete installation projects.
Demolition Labourer
Demolition workers may assist with removing structures, clearing debris, and preparing sites for new construction while following strict safety procedures.

Working Conditions
Construction labourers may work on residential buildings, commercial properties, roads, bridges, factories, warehouses, and infrastructure projects.
The job can be physically demanding. Workers may stand for long periods, lift heavy materials, bend, climb, work outdoors, and perform repetitive tasks. Weather conditions can also affect outdoor construction work. Employees must follow safety procedures and use appropriate protective equipment.
Typical workplaces include:
- Residential construction sites
- Commercial buildings
- Road and highway projects
- Industrial facilities
- Warehouses
- Infrastructure projects
- Renovation sites
Working hours can vary depending on the project. Some workers may work during the day, while others may have early morning starts, overtime, weekends, or seasonal schedules.
